Why the Government Canceled the 2026 Cigarette Excise Hike

Monday, October 13, 2025

Finance Minister Purbaya Yudhi Sadewa imposes a moratorium on next year’s cigarette excise rates increase, favoring industry over public health.

DOZENS of flower boards lined the courtyard of the Ministry of Finance office at Lapangan Banteng, Central Jakarta, on Tuesday, September 30, 2025. The messages varied, from words of thanks and praise to sarcasm and condemnation. The colorful displays reflected public reactions to Finance Minister Purbaya Yudhi Sadewa’s decision to freeze cigarette excise rate increases for 2026.
